An American documentary series called Slow Burn is decent. The first couple of series deal with a couple of historical footnotes (Watergate and the impeachment of Bill Clinton) but skip to series three for the really big story.. Tupac and Biggie. The last episode left me pretty emotional as it really gives a sense that the Las Vegas police had no interest in prosecuting anyone over Tupac’s murder and Biggie’s murder investigation in LA was a shambles at best.

Tupac looked like he was always going to be a tragic figure but Biggie planned a quiet life away from fame to raise his kids. Some really good interviews with folk close to both of them.
